Price Chopper store closing in Overland Park
Balls Food Stores announced this week that one of its grocery stores in Johnson County, Kansas, will be closing permanently.
The company said in a statement on Tuesday that it has decided to close its Price Chopper store located at 75th Street and Metcalf Avenue in Overland Park. It said the store will shut its doors after ...
